Frozen Rail Jam is back for 2015! We are really excited to kick off the Ontario winter season with the return of Ontario’s largest freestyle ski and snowboard rail jam in partnership with the All Aboard Demo Tour.


Freestyle skiers and snowboarders are encouraged to come out and get their ‘trick on'. Categories will consist of Grom’s 12 & under, Amateur, Open and Women’s for both ski and snowboard. With $1,500 cash on the line and tons of prizes from DC, Mountain Hardware, Rockstar, Now, King Snow, Forecast Ski Magazine, Yes, Oakey, Ride, Burton, Coors Light, Vans and K2, you can expect to see some heavy hitters throwing down big tricks on the rails.

Spectators can join the crowd from the sidelines, or at our Coors Light Beer Garden, and try out the latest snowboard gear at the All Aboard Demo Tour.

Don’t miss the official Kick-off Party at Jozo’s on Friday, December 18th, starting at 8 p.m. We will be showing three of this season’s all-encompassing shred flicks including Déjà vu’s Encore, DCP’s The Balance Project and Gigi Ruff’s Follow Your Nose.

Registration

Frozen Rail Jam Registration will take place Friday, December 18 at 8:30 - 9:30 a.m. in the Cascade Room, Grand Central Lodge. Athletes under the age of 18 MUST have a parent or legal guardian on-site to sign the event waiver, OR have their parent sign the online event waiver listed here at bluemountain.ca/eventwaiver. Helmet & park pass are mandatory for all participants.

Entry Fee

$20 + HST
A valid lift ticket* or seasons pass is required to participate in the Frozen Rail Jam.
*Participants must have a valid Event Lift Ticket (discounted to $39+HST) which includes a one-time terrain park pass OR a valid Blue Mountain Season Pass and terrain park pass. All registration fees are paid on-site.
